Table 7-1 Description of Fields for Ethernet Port Attributes
Field Description
alignmentErrs Number of frames received by this port that are not an integral
number of octets in length and do not pass the FCS check
carrierSenseErr Number of frames discarded because the carrier sense condition
was lost while attempting to transmit a frame from this port
collisions Number of collisions detected on this port
duplexMode Current duplex mode setting. Possible values are full, half, and not
applicable (n/a). Duplex mode is not applicable on the Switch 2200.
excessCollision Number of frames that could not be transmitted on this port
because the maximum allowed number of collisions was exceeded
excessDeferrals Number of frames that could not be transmitted on this port
because the maximum allowed deferral time was exceeded
fcsErrs Number of frames received by this port that are an integral number
of octets in length but do not pass the FCS check
lateCollisions Number of times a collision was detected on this port later than 512
bit-times into the transmission of a frame
lengthErrs Number of frames received by this port longer than 1518 bytes or
shorter than 64 bytes
linkStatus Boolean value indicating the current state of the physical link status
for this port (either enabled or disabled)
macAddress The MAC address of this port
noRxBuffers Number of frames discarded because there was no available buffer
space
